Lafayette Parish, LA vs Salt Lake County, UT
Property Tax Rate Comparison 2025
Quick Answer
Lafayette Parish, LA: 0.42% effective rate · $524/yr median tax · median home $124,819
Salt Lake County, UT: 0.65% effective rate · $2,414/yr median tax · median home $371,403
Side-by-Side Comparison
| Metric | Lafayette Parish, LA | Salt Lake County, UT | National Avg |
|---|---|---|---|
| Effective Tax Rate | 0.42% | 0.65% | 1.06% |
| Median Annual Tax | $524 | $2,414 | $2,778 |
| Median Home Value | $124,819 | $371,403 | $268,728 |
| Population | 244,390 | 1,160,437 | — |
